Govt in favor of freedom of the press: Communications Minister Karki



KATHMANDU: Minister for Communications and Information Technology Gyanendra Karki has said that the government was in favor of freedom of the press and was with the media professionals to help the communications sector to prosper.

Minister Karki has reaffirmed the government’s commitment to continuous collaboration with the media sector.

He has also called for contribution from all quarters to the incumbent’s government aspiration to make Nepal a prosperous country within a decade.

Karki claimed the communication sector had significantly contributed to every political change in the country.
